I started feeding my tig by throwing food at it's head. Literally. They r rubbish hunters. mine took pellets by day 7.
No need to do the above any more, I just throw food in the tank and the tig gets what he can.
It's gone from 7.5 inch to 8.5 inch in 7 weeks. It does not feeding daily.
The markings are gettig whiter and blacker all the time. The tank mates are a Leo , and tiger fish. So no other catfish to compete with. Some members have posted top advice in some recent tig threads.
I definately do all I can to ensure it gets no Prawns when I feed prawns by throwing food at opposite end Of tank the tig is in.
Catfish typically eat most type of food so pellets should be quite easy to convert too.
The experienced tig keepers say make sure it doesn't get bloated by overfeedIng, especially with prawns muscles etc. So I have taken that on board. I would hate to be the cause of reason should it die from overfeeding.
I have no hiding spaces and the tig is absoluteltly fine. It's cheeks are starting to get a blue tint.
